DataMuseum.dk

Presents historical artifacts from the history of:

Philips Data Systems

This is an automatic "excavation" of a thematic subset of
artifacts from Datamuseum.dk's BitArchive.

See our Wiki for more about Philips Data Systems

Excavated with: AutoArchaeologist - Free & Open Source Software.


top - metrics - download

⟦ad1059ffc⟧

    Length: 1298 (0x512)
    Notes: pts_type(SC)
    Names: »DVTOD.SC«

Derivation

└─⟦110b7ed5e⟧ Bits:30009664 Philips computer tape "600106"
    └─⟦this⟧ »TOSSWORK/DVTOD.SC« 

PTS(SC)

	IDENT DVTOD 	REL 9.2 79-11-16  870105040920

*  OPTICAL DOCUMENT READER DEVICE WORK TABLE
* 
	ENTRY	DVTOD	TABLE ENTRY
*** 
	EXTRN	ODAD	POINTER TO ADDRESSBLOCK 
***** 
MMUPAG	EQU	0	MEMORY MANAGEMENT UNIT CONDITION 
* 
DVTOD	EQU	*	TABLE ENTRY 
	DATA	/1111	CHANNEL PARAMETER 
	DATA	/8000	STATUS./8000 MEANS DEVICE READY 
	DATA	0	ECB ADRESS
	DATA	DWTEND-DVTOD	ORDER
	DATA	ODAD	POINTER TO ADDRESS BLOCK 
	DATA	'OD'	TTAB-ADDRESS 
	DATA	0	WAIT/INDICATE INDICATOR 
	DATA	0	TERMINAL QUEUE
	IFT	MMUPAG=1 
	DATA	0	USER ECB ADDRESS
	DATA	DEVECB	MMU ECB ADDRESS
	XIF
	DATA	0	CODE CONVERSION TABLE POINTER 
	DATA	0	SAVE AREA FOR A3
	DATA	0	SAVE AREA FOR A4
	DATA	0	SAVE AREA FOR A5
	RES	4	DWT-STACK
	DATA	0	TIMER POINTER 
	DATA	0	0O DEVICE 
	DATA	0	
	DATA	0	LRC-ACKUMULATOR 
	DATA	DWTSQ+DVTOD	POINTER TO FIRST PLACE IN QUEUE 
	DATA	DWTSQ+DVTOD	POINTER TO LAST PLACE IN QUEUE
DWTSQ	EQU	*-DVTOD 
	RES	0
* 
	IFT	MMUPAG=1 
DEVECB	EQU	*
	DATA	0,0,0,0,0,0 
	XIF
* 
DWTEND	EQU	*
* 
	END

HexDump

0x000…034 (0, 0, 400) Head {h00=0x0030, h01=0x0050, text=» IDENT DVTOD  REL 9.2 79-11-16  870105040920«, t00=0x0000, t01=0x0004}
0x034…03c             Head {h00=0x0004, h01=0x0050, t00=0x0000, t01=0x0038}
0x03c…070             Head {h00=0x0030, h01=0x0050, text=»*  OPTICAL DOCUMENT READER DEVICE WORK TABLE«, t00=0x0000, t01=0x0040}
0x070…07a             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x0074}
0x07a…09a             Head {h00=0x001c, h01=0x0050, text=» ENTRY DVTOD TABLE ENTRY«, t00=0x0000, t01=0x007e}
0x09a…0a6             Head {h00=0x0008, h01=0x0050, text=»*** «, t00=0x0000, t01=0x009e}
0x0a6…0d2             Head {h00=0x0028, h01=0x0050, text=» EXTRN ODAD POINTER TO ADDRESSBLOCK «, t00=0x0000, t01=0x00aa}
0x0d2…0e0             Head {h00=0x000a, h01=0x0050, text=»***** «, t00=0x0000, t01=0x00d6}
0x0e0…116             Head {h00=0x0032, h01=0x0050, text=»MMUPAG EQU 0 MEMORY MANAGEMENT UNIT CONDITION «, t00=0x0000, t01=0x00e4}
0x116…120             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x011a}
0x120…140             Head {h00=0x001c, h01=0x0050, text=»DVTOD EQU * TABLE ENTRY «, t00=0x0000, t01=0x0124}
0x140…166             Head {h00=0x0022, h01=0x0050, text=» DATA /1111 CHANNEL PARAMETER «, t00=0x0000, t01=0x0144}
0x166…19a             Head {h00=0x0030, h01=0x0050, text=» DATA /8000 STATUS./8000 MEANS DEVICE READY «, t00=0x0000, t01=0x016a}
0x19a…1b4             Head {h00=0x0016, h01=0x0050, text=» DATA 0 ECB ADRESS«, t00=0x0001, t01=0x000e}
0x1b4…1d4             Head {h00=0x001c, h01=0x0050, text=» DATA DWTEND-DVTOD ORDER«, t00=0x0001, t01=0x0028}
0x1d4…200             Head {h00=0x0028, h01=0x0050, text=» DATA ODAD POINTER TO ADDRESS BLOCK «, t00=0x0001, t01=0x0048}
0x200…220             Head {h00=0x001c, h01=0x0050, text=» DATA 'OD' TTAB-ADDRESS «, t00=0x0001, t01=0x0074}
0x220…248             Head {h00=0x0024, h01=0x0050, text=» DATA 0 WAIT/INDICATE INDICATOR «, t00=0x0001, t01=0x0094}
0x248…266             Head {h00=0x001a, h01=0x0050, text=» DATA 0 TERMINAL QUEUE«, t00=0x0001, t01=0x00bc}
0x266…27c             Head {h00=0x0012, h01=0x0050, text=» IFT MMUPAG=1 «, t00=0x0001, t01=0x00da}
0x27c…29c             Head {h00=0x001c, h01=0x0050, text=» DATA 0 USER ECB ADDRESS«, t00=0x0001, t01=0x00f0}
0x29c…2c0             Head {h00=0x0020, h01=0x0050, text=» DATA DEVECB MMU ECB ADDRESS«, t00=0x0001, t01=0x0110}
0x2c0…2cc             Head {h00=0x0008, h01=0x0050, text=» XIF«, t00=0x0001, t01=0x0134}
0x2cc…2fa             Head {h00=0x002a, h01=0x0050, text=» DATA 0 CODE CONVERSION TABLE POINTER «, t00=0x0001, t01=0x0140}
0x2fa…31a             Head {h00=0x001c, h01=0x0050, text=» DATA 0 SAVE AREA FOR A3«, t00=0x0001, t01=0x016e}
0x31a…33a             Head {h00=0x001c, h01=0x0050, text=» DATA 0 SAVE AREA FOR A4«, t00=0x0001, t01=0x018e}
0x33a…35a             Head {h00=0x001c, h01=0x0050, text=» DATA 0 SAVE AREA FOR A5«, t00=0x0002, t01=0x001e}
0x35a…372             Head {h00=0x0014, h01=0x0050, text=» RES 4 DWT-STACK«, t00=0x0002, t01=0x003e}
0x372…390             Head {h00=0x001a, h01=0x0050, text=» DATA 0 TIMER POINTER «, t00=0x0002, t01=0x0056}
0x390…3aa             Head {h00=0x0016, h01=0x0050, text=» DATA 0 0O DEVICE «, t00=0x0002, t01=0x0074}
0x3aa…3ba             Head {h00=0x000c, h01=0x0050, text=» DATA 0 «, t00=0x0002, t01=0x008e}
0x3ba…3da             Head {h00=0x001c, h01=0x0050, text=» DATA 0 LRC-ACKUMULATOR «, t00=0x0002, t01=0x009e}
0x3da…414             Head {h00=0x0036, h01=0x0050, text=» DATA DWTSQ+DVTOD POINTER TO FIRST PLACE IN QUEUE «, t00=0x0002, t01=0x00be}
0x414…44c             Head {h00=0x0034, h01=0x0050, text=» DATA DWTSQ+DVTOD POINTER TO LAST PLACE IN QUEUE«, t00=0x0002, t01=0x00f8}
0x44c…466             Head {h00=0x0016, h01=0x0050, text=»DWTSQ EQU *-DVTOD «, t00=0x0002, t01=0x0130}
0x466…474             Head {h00=0x000a, h01=0x0050, text=» RES 0«, t00=0x0002, t01=0x014a}
0x474…47e             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0002, t01=0x0158}
0x47e…494             Head {h00=0x0012, h01=0x0050, text=» IFT MMUPAG=1 «, t00=0x0002, t01=0x0162}
0x494…4a8             Head {h00=0x0010, h01=0x0050, text=»DEVECB EQU *«, t00=0x0002, t01=0x0178}
0x4a8…4c2             Head {h00=0x0016, h01=0x0050, text=» DATA 0,0,0,0,0,0 «, t00=0x0002, t01=0x018c}
0x4c2…4ce             Head {h00=0x0008, h01=0x0050, text=» XIF«, t00=0x0003, t01=0x0016}
0x4ce…4d8             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0003, t01=0x0022}
0x4d8…4ec             Head {h00=0x0010, h01=0x0050, text=»DWTEND EQU *«, t00=0x0003, t01=0x002c}
0x4ec…4f6             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0003, t01=0x0040}
0x4f6…502             Head {h00=0x0008, h01=0x0050, text=» END«, t00=0x0003, t01=0x004a}
0x502…506             Head {h00=0x4004, h01=0x0000}
0x506…50a             00 03 00 56                                                                                                                                                                                                                                       ┆   V┆
0x50a…512 (4, 1, 8)   20 04 00 00 00 04 00 04                                                                                                                                                                                                                           ┆        ┆

Reduced view